Output 587109074c50444bb1f7cc18269148752af9dd1bf02a77d1bdfd69a349c8fcbe:0

value
1305494
script pubkey
OP_0 OP_PUSHBYTES_20 81d13a29dd1623d3261d25e9cafb7e7103a9a669
address
bc1qs8gn52wazc3axfsayh5u47m7wyp6nfnfnzz9kr
transaction
587109074c50444bb1f7cc18269148752af9dd1bf02a77d1bdfd69a349c8fcbe
confirmations
174315
spent
true